My boyfriend and I decided to check out this Cafe after I saw great reviews online about the food and atmosphere. Went this morning for breakfast. The inside of the cafe was very beautiful and bright and welcoming. However, the service we received during our time here was the absolute opposite of that. I got a cappuccino and the rancheros breakfast. My boyfriend got an espresso, fresh orange juice, and the morty breakfast sandwich with the potatoes on the side. The espresso was one of the worst espressos we’ve ever had which was really unfortunate. It was extremely watery and bitter to the point in which he couldn’t even drink it (added sugar afterwards and still that couldn’t help it). My boyfriend’s breakfast sandwich was very good. The potatoes were alright as the texture was good but kind of bland. My breakfast was alright. It really lacked flavour and good textures which was unfortunate. I had to season my plate with more salt and pepper as well as the potatoes.

The server we had was very unpleasant and rude. Barely checked on us throughout our time, and we felt rushed through our visit. We waited a long while after we finished our meal for our server to come back.

After paying, she just took the machine and as she started to walk away (without staying or looking at us) said “have a good day”. That was really rude and disrespectful. Throughout our stay, our waitress would respond back to us saying “huh, what” with a rude tone in her voice. We noticed other tables with the same waitress getting better and faster service than us.

Overall, was not impressed with the customer service we received. It’s difficult to go out to eat due to rising costs, and therefore make it a special occasion to go out. The breakfast was on the pricier end which is more than fine if the customer service and the entirety of the meal add up to it. Excellent customer service is very important to me, and it should be important to all employees. Will not be returning, first and last time.

Update: I was given an email to email back regarding my experience. I still have not heard back, emailed 4 days ago. I will update when/if I hear back and any follow up has happened.

UPDATE: I finally received an email from the manager or “Brad”. A week and a half later. All that he sent was “ Hello Alexandra, What did you want to discuss further?”

I’m very surprised and shocked by this email. After my negative experience I was told by Brad to email him and he would help if I ever wanted to return to the cafe. However from this email sent much later, it is very clear that the management at this cafe do not put their customers first (nor want to improve on negative customer service). Another email sent if I wanted to give him a call to discuss this further. Overall, nothing further to discuss.

I definitely will be telling my friends and family not to come to this cafe as I am just surprised at how management deals with negative customer reviews. This is just my...

For my girlfriend’s birthday on May 7th, I wanted to treat her to a nice weekday brunch since her evening was already booked. Even though it meant driving a bit farther from Mississauga, I chose Kerr St Café based on their weekday brunch menu, beautiful interior, and strong reviews.

When we arrived, the café was understandably busy, they don’t take reservations in advance. We were told there would be a 30-minute wait, so we took a short stroll around the cute neighborhood.

By the time we returned around 1:40 PM, the brunch rush had settled and the restaurant was much quieter. As we were shown to our table, we noticed a few empty spots near the windows. Instead, we were seated at a two-seater tucked against a wall, separated from the rest of the dining area by a high-traffic walkway. The table felt quite isolated.

As first-time guests, we tried to stay open-minded, maybe there was a seating flow we didn’t understand. But we couldn’t help but notice that the young-looking female server who seated us gave off a cold, reluctant energy, like she didn’t want to serve us but had to. I wasn’t looking to “pull the race card,” and I truly didn’t want to believe that how we looked had anything to do with it, but I also couldn’t think of any other reason why we’d be treated that way. It’s hard not to wonder when there’s no obvious cause for the coldness, especially as visible Asian minorities. I made a conscious choice to focus on celebrating my girlfriend’s birthday and enjoying our time together.

It wasn’t until recently that I asked her how she felt about the experience and without hesitation, she shared the same discomfort. She pointed out that even more tables continued to open up throughout our meal, making the seating choice feel more intentional in hindsight. To add to that feeling, when the server took our order, she asked me how I wanted my eggs, but didn’t ask my girlfriend the same. Instead, she turned to her and simply asked, “Do you want the same?” It was a small thing, but it added to the overall impression, like my girlfriend wasn’t being seen as a full guest in her own right. She later mentioned she hadn’t expected that and felt a bit dismissed in that moment.

To be fair, the food was great, the decor was beautiful, and most of the other staff were friendly, including the bartender who warmly said goodbye as we left.

But here’s the thing: if this is the kind of culture they’re consciously or unconsciously creating, where minorities don’t feel welcomed, then good job, because that’s exactly the message being sent. But if the goal is to create an inclusive space where everyone can enjoy great food, ambiance, and service, then this might be something worth reflecting on and addressing.

We’re sharing this in the spirit of honesty and in hopes that feedback like this leads to greater awareness and a more welcoming experience for all...

I had the pleasure of visiting Kerr Street Café in Oakville again, and once more, it did not disappoint! The ambiance is warm and inviting, with a modern yet cozy aesthetic that makes it the perfect spot for a relaxed brunch. Despite being quite busy, we managed to get seated after a 40-minute wait, which, given the café’s popularity, was completely understandable. And let me tell you—it was absolutely worth it!

Latte – A Smooth and Comforting Sip ☕

We started with a latte, and it was simply perfection in a cup. The balance between the espresso and milk was just right—rich, velvety, and beautifully frothed. Served in a well-presented cup, the latte had a delicate, aromatic espresso flavor with subtle nutty undertones. The foam on top was thick and creamy, making each sip feel like a warm hug.

Blueberry Pancakes – A Fluffy Indulgence 🥞

Next up were the blueberry pancakes, which were soft, fluffy, and cooked to perfection. The moment they arrived at our table, the aroma of warm pancakes mixed with the sweetness of fresh blueberries was absolutely tempting. Each bite was pillowy soft, bursting with juicy blueberries and drizzled with just the right amount of golden maple syrup, adding a delicious caramelized sweetness without being overpowering. To top it off, a dollop of butter melted beautifully into the stack, making them irresistibly indulgent.

French Toast – A Decadent Treat 🍞🍯

The French toast was another highlight of our meal—thick-cut, golden brown, and perfectly crispy on the outside, yet soft and custardy on the inside. It was lightly dusted with powdered sugar, adding just the right amount of sweetness, and was paired with fresh berries that provided a refreshing contrast. The syrup drizzled over it complemented the buttery texture, making every bite rich, flavorful, and satisfying.

Final Thoughts – A Must-Visit Café!

Even though this was my second time visiting Kerr Street Café, I find myself wanting to come back more often. The only challenge? The café closes at 4 PM, and I’ve missed a few opportunities to visit simply because I couldn’t make it in time. If you’re looking for a top-tier brunch experience in Oakville, this place is an absolute must-visit. Whether you’re craving a perfectly brewed latte, indulgent blueberry pancakes, or the best French toast in town, you won’t be disappointed.

I highly recommend arriving early to secure a table, but even with a wait, the quality of food and service makes it completely worthwhile! Can’t wait to return for another...
